Pennsylvania's First Private Wild Plant Sanctuary Designated

HARRISBURG, Pa., June 17 /PRNewswire-USNewswire/ -- Acting Secretary of 
Conservation and Natural Resources John Quigley today announced that 
Pennsylvania is designating its first Private Wild Plant Sanctuary.

The 7.6-acre property owned by Michael and Barbara Yavorosky is located in 
Fell Township, Lackawanna County, and Clinton Township, Wayne County. The 
Yavoroskys, of nearby Hop Bottom, are committed to preserving the site in 
perpetuity and welcome the public to visit the sanctuary.
